How To Fix /SMB/Q2P011 - Setting transport attribute: &1 = &2


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SMB/Q2P -

  • Message number: 011

  • Message text: Setting transport attribute: &1 = &2

    The SAP error message /SMB/Q2P011 Setting transport attribute: &1 = &2 typically relates to issues with transport attributes in the context of SAP's transport management system (TMS). This error can occur during the transport of objects between different SAP systems (e.g., from development to quality assurance or production).

    Cause:

    1. Incorrect Transport Attributes: The error may arise if there are incorrect or missing transport attributes for the objects being transported. This can happen if the transport request is not properly configured or if there are inconsistencies in the transport settings.

    2.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the user executing the transport may not have the necessary authorizations to set or modify transport attributes.

    3. System Configuration Issues: There may be configuration issues in the transport landscape or in the transport directory.

    4. Version Compatibility: If the objects being transported are not compatible with the target system version, it may lead to this error.

    Solution:

    1. Check Transport Request: Review the transport request to ensure that all necessary attributes are correctly set. You can do this in the Transport Organizer (SE09 or SE10).

    2. Review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to perform the transport. You may need to check the roles and profiles assigned to the user.

    3. Transport Directory: Check the transport directory for any inconsistencies or issues. You can use transaction STMS to access the Transport Management System and verify the configuration.

    4. System Compatibility: Ensure that the source and target systems are compatible in terms of version and configuration. If there are discrepancies, you may need to adjust the objects or the transport settings.

    5. Consult SAP Notes: Look for rel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error. SAP frequently updates its knowledge base with solutions for known issues.

    6. Debugging: If the issue persists, consider debugging the transport process to identify the exact point of failure. This may require technical expertise.

    Related Information:

    • SAP Transport Management System (TMS): Familiarize yourself with the TMS, as it is crucial for managing transports between different SAP systems.
    • Transaction Codes: Use transaction codes like SE09, SE10, and STMS for managing transport requests and checking the transport landscape.
